Explore this 15-minute conference talk that examines the trade-offs between prediction accuracy and timing in AI systems. Learn how delays in obtaining more accurate predictions can create hidden costs in social and economic applications, as researchers Ali Shirali, Ariel D. Procaccia, and Rediet Abebe present their findings on the temporal dynamics of machine learning decision-making. Discover the implications for AI applications in social and economic systems, where the value of immediate decisions must be weighed against the benefits of waiting for improved predictive accuracy. Gain insights into how timing considerations affect the practical deployment of AI systems and understand the economic and social consequences of prediction delays in real-world scenarios.
